Let us suppose we have some article reported on a study of potential sources of injury to equine veterinarians conducted at a
university veterinary hospital. Forces on the hand were measured for several common activities that veterinarians engage in when
examining or treating horses. We will consider the forces on the hands for two tasks, lifting and using ultrasound. Assume that both
sample sizes are 6, the sample mean force for lifting was 6.2 pounds with standard deviation 1.5 pounds, and the sample mean force
for using ultrasound was 6.4 pounds with standard deviation 0.3 pounds. Assume that the standard deviations are known.
Suppose that you wanted to detect a true difference in mean force of 0.25 pounds on the hands for these two activities. Under the null
hypothesis, 40 = 0. What level of type II error would you recommend here?
